Prepaid Energy Management

Maitreyee Marathe, Prof. Line Roald
University of Wisconsin-Madison

  • datasets - used to store data for experiments.
  • simple-experiments - to run experiments with simulation durations as a multiple of 1 day. Data present in files datasets/simple-experiment-data-1.csv, datasets/simple-experiment-data-2.csv, and datasets/simple-experiment-data-3.csv can be used.
  • monthly-experiments - to run experiments with simulation durations as a multiple of 1 month. Residential electricity usage data can be obtained from Pecan Street Dataport.
  • In each folder, run the file main.jl, supporting functions are present in functions.jl.
